Daniela is a protein chemist with a background in structural biology. She has more than 15 years of experience on working with proteins at the bench in different settings. Among other positions, Daniela spent four years at Plexxikon where she worked in the protein chemistry department and contributed to its platform by providing purified drug targets for assays and structural biology. Daniela received her PhD from University of Calabria, Italy meanwhile she conducted her research in Tom Alber’s laboratory at University of California, Berkeley.
